Middletown Township Municipal Center
Middletown Township Municipal Center is a town hall in Middletown Township, Bucks County, Pennsylvania. Middletown Township Municipal Center is situated nearby to Tareyton Park, as well as near Langhorne Post Office.Places of Interest Nearby

Woodbourne station
Railway station

Woodbourne station is a train station located on Woodbourne Road in Middletown Township, Pennsylvania along the SEPTA West Trenton Line which terminates at West Trenton station in Ewing, New Jersey, and also on the CSX Trenton Subdivision which has a freight yard not far by the station. Woodbourne station is situated 1 mile northeast of Middletown Township Municipal Center.
Core Creek Park
Park
Core Creek Park, a county park within Bucks County, Pennsylvania. It sits within Middletown Township on 1,200 acres. The park surrounds Lake Luxembourg, which was formed by a dam on Core Creek. The park opens at dawn and closes at dusk. Core Creek Park is situated 1½ miles northwest of Middletown Township Municipal Center.
Oxford Valley Mall
Shopping center

The Oxford Valley Mall is a two-story shopping mall, managed and 85.5 percent-owned by the Simon Property Group, that is located next to the Sesame Place amusement park near Langhorne in Middletown Township, Bucks County, Pennsylvania. Oxford Valley Mall is situated 1½ miles east of Middletown Township Municipal Center.
